Shape Anglian Water’s data-driven future as a Data Technology Architect

At Anglian Water, we’re driving digital transformation to deliver smarter, more sustainable solutions. As a Data Platform Architect within our Digital, Data and Technology (DDaT) team, you’ll play a critical role in defining and governing the architecture of our core data and analytics platforms; spanning Microsoft Azure, Data Bricks, SAP Datasphere, and MQTT-based time series environments. This role ensures that these platforms are secure, reliable, and strategically aligned, while enabling data-led business transformation through clear standards, patterns, and frameworks.

What you will be doing
  • Define and maintain data platform architecture with blueprints aligned to enterprise strategy and target architectures, with a strong focus on data interoperability and governance.
  • Embed robust governance in line with cyber security, data governance, and service operations policies.
  • Design and maintain a cohesive data architecture ensuring platform spaces are structured to support suitable data integration (acquire) data product creation and lineage tracking (organise), and scalable analytics workflows.
  • Design integration and interoperability patterns that connect platforms and enable data sharing across IT and OT environments.
  • Enable self-service adoption through reusable frameworks, templates, and reference architectures—empowering data analysts, engineers, and citizen developers.
  • Own data technology strategy, roadmap, and lifecycle management—planning upgrades, replacements, and reducing technical debt for data-centric platforms.
  • Monitor and improve platform health, performance, and observability, consolidating technologies where appropriate to support data quality and analytics.
